Report: 2 MLB All-Star trade candidates are off the market

The number of available MLB stars on the trade market appears to be dwindling.

Atlanta Braves catcher Sean Murphy will not be available for trade ahead of the July 31 deadline, Buster Olney of ESPN reported on Tuesday. Additionally, Cleveland Guardians outfielder Steven Kwan is unlikely to be moved as well, Olney added.

The 30-year-old Murphy, an All-Star in 2023, is batting .240 with 16 home runs and 38 RBIs this season for the Braves. Meanwhile, the 27-year-old Kwan is batting .288 with six home runs, 32 RBIs, and 11 stolen bases for the Guardians, numbers that were good enough for Kwan to make his second career All-Star appearance this year.

A common thread for both players is that their respective teams have underperformed in 2025. The Braves are a miserable 44-55, and the Guardians are only slightly better at 49-50. Those underachieving records have given rise to trade speculation surrounding both teams.

However, both Murphy and Kwan are under contract for multiple more years at very reasonable salaries. Murphy is set to make $15 million in each of the next three seasons (with the Braves holding a $15 million team option on him in 2029 as well). As for Kwan, he still has two more years left of arbitration eligibility before potentially becoming a free agent after the 2027 season.

There could still be a lot of movement ahead of this year’s trade deadline, particularly with some marquee teams looking to buy. But those teams will probably be out of luck if they are eyeing a potential move for Murphy or Kwan before July 31.
